Fresh Dill Dip

This fresh dill dip is quick and easy to make with sour cream, cream cheese, fresh dill, spices, and a touch of honey.

Ingredients

  • 16 ounces Sour Cream
  • 8 ounces Cream Cheese softened
  • 2 tablespoons Fresh Dill chopped, plus a little for garnish if desired
  • 2 teaspoons Honey
  • ½ teaspoon Garlic Powder
  • ½ teaspoon Salt plus a pinch or two if needed
  • Pinch Black Pepper
  • Dash Cayenne Pepper optional – leave it out if you don’t like spicy

Here are some great ideas for Dippers

  • Chips
  • Broccoli florets
  • Carrot sticks
  • Grape or cherry tomatoes
  • Butter crackers
  • Pretzels
  • Cucumber sliced rounds or spears

Instructions

  • Add all of the ingredients to a large bowl and mix well until all of the ingredients are incorporated.
  • Use a fork to get everything going. Then use a rubber spatula to scrape the sides, and to get to the bottom and fold the dip over while stirring.
  • Taste the dip and add a little salt and pepper, if needed.
  • Cover the bowl and refrigerate until it’s chilled. Just give it a good stir before serving.
  • Garnish the dip with a little extra chopped dill, and serve it with your favorite chips or fresh veggies.
